We didn't no

We gave up and took it to a garage, and they took 3 hours to find the problem!
The bike has LED indicators, and to stop them flashing really quickly, they kept the old ones on, but under the seat. Apparently, there is a wire under there that is to do with the built in factory fitted yamaha alarm or something, and probably is having moved the indicators and put them back, the wire was put under pressure and broke, which cut off everything like fuel etc. so effectively worked as an immobiliser. So £200 for a 3 minute job, which would have cost us about 30p lol.
